Sikhs stuck at Afghanistan Gurdwara are safe, says Delhi Sikh body

New Delhi, Aug 21 (TIWN) The Delhi Sikh Gurdwara Management Committee has denied that Sikhs living in Afghanistan have been kidnapped by the Taliban even as the security situation in the war-torn country has further deteriorated.
His statement comes just hours after reports emerged saying that some Afghan Sikhs and Hindus were today stopped from boarding an Indian Air Force (IAF) plane. They had been waiting outside the airport since Friday. However, they were sent back from the Kabul airport.
